Discuție Wikipedia:Twinkle

Active discussions

Erori în pag. de discuțiiModificare

Nu prea funcționează corect această unealtă. Am cerut o ȘR prin TW/CȘR și în pagina de discuții a lui Tonicarul a apărut {{subst:db-a11-notice|Tonicarul|nowelcome=|{{{key1}}}={{{value1}}}}}. Rog un coleg mult mai experimentat în acest domeniu să verifice și să rezolve problema (nu vreau să stau o oră să rezolv dacă altcineva ar rezolva problema în 5min.). --_ Florinvorbărieisprăvi 10 iunie 2012 17:33 (EEST)

Am creat un redirect de la {{db-a11-notice}} la {{au-pg-nouă1}}. Pentru a rezolva complet problema, ar trebui create și paginile {{db-a1-notice}}, {{db-a2-notice}}, etc (traducând conținutul de la en:Template:db-a1-notice, en:Template:db-a2-notice, etc sau identificând formatele de avertizare echivalente de la noi). Răzvan Socol mesaj 10 iunie 2012 20:38 (EEST)
Și la cererea de ștergere rapidă pe criteriul G12 (Încălcare evidentă a drepturilor de autor) pe pagina de discuții a utilizatorului vinovat de „copyvio” apare un mesaj eronat: „pagina... nu are niciun fel de conținut, fie e compus doar din legături externe, o secțiune „Vezi și”, referințe la cărți, formate, categorii, legături interwiki, reformulări sau repetări ale titlului, sau tentative de a contacta subiectul articolului...”. --Bătrânul (discuție) 13 octombrie 2014 19:06 (EEST)

BuguriModificare

Hai să colecționăm buguri de Twinkle, ca să știm de ele și/sau să le rezolvăm--Strainu (دسستي‎)  17 decembrie 2016 01:01 (EET)

  1. La propunerile de ștergere nu se face întotdeauna purge corect, ori la pagina propusă ori la WP:PȘ. Treaba e intermitentă și nu am găsit o regulă.
    Cred că s-a rezolvat după ce am refactorizat puțin pe bază de Promise-uri și API nou. —Andreidiscuție 10 ianuarie 2017 10:58 (EET)
    Nu cred, la asta a trebuit să dau purge și la pagină și la articol.--Strainu (دسستي‎)  10 ianuarie 2017 11:21 (EET)
    Ciudat, la mine nu s-a mai întâmplat deloc, nici cu Chromium, nici cu Firefox. Dacă mai reproduci, încearcă să te uiți și în consolă, poate sunt niște mesaje de eroare care ajută. —Andreidiscuție 12 ianuarie 2017 12:09 (EET)
    Andrei Stroe, vezi starea curentă a paginii de propuneri, precum și Ziua fără datorii (17 noiembrie). Problema a devenit probabil mai rară, dar tot există.--Strainu (دسستي‎)  16 ianuarie 2017 16:49 (EET)
    Am mai umblat azi și am adăugat un nou parametru la cererea de patrulare, dar cum eu nu mai reproduceam nici după ultima modificare, am nevoie să știu mai multe despre cum se comportă. —Andreidiscuție 25 ianuarie 2017 18:43 (EET)
    I s-a întâmplat și lui Accipiter Q. Gentilis la seria de azi. Mie nu mi s-a întâmplat la cele 2 propuse. Din păcate nu avem informații noi despre reproducere.--Strainu (دسستي‎)  31 ianuarie 2017 19:00 (EET)
    Mi s-a întîmplat și ieri la câteva pagini, dar am rezolvat ciobănește, permutând succesiv formatele în pagina care sumează paginile cu discuții de ștergere sau accesând linkul de generarea unei pagini de discuții despre ștergere pentru pagina propusă și apoi revenind la PDȘ. Astăzi nu amers decât cu a doua variantă, pe ici pe colo.--Accipiter Q. Gentilis(D) 31 ianuarie 2017 19:10 (EET) P.S. Am grupat paginile restante cu astfel de probleme și le-am specificat la PDȘ cu <!-- -->
    Am propus un articol cu consola deschisă și primesc 2 clase de erori:
    • ceva cu malformed XML, nu apuc să o citesc complet, vedem dacă pot să o găsesc prin loguri.
    • erori de salvare: Adaug discuția la listă: error "error" occurred while contacting the API. și Adaug discuția la listă: Failed to save edit: error "error" occurred while contacting the API. --Strainu (دسستي‎)  2 mai 2017 12:18 (EEST)
  2. La închiderea unei propuneri de ștergere din altă parte decât de la WP:PȘ titlul articolului este obținut greșit.
    Că propunerea se închide doar din WP:PȘ este o prezumție a modulului. Poate ar trebui să fie limitată apariția linkului la acea pagină. —Andreidiscuție 12 ianuarie 2017 12:10 (EET)
  3. Data de închidere este luată GMT (?) Vezi semnătura vs. data aici.
    Nice catch. Se folosea funcția parser time, care funcționează în UTC. Am înlocuit cu timel care pune data în funcție de setările locale ale wikiului, vezi 1 august 2020 10:35 versus 1 august 2020 13:35. —Andreidiscuție 10 ianuarie 2017 11:06 (EET)
  4. Dacă există o a doua propunere de ștergere a unui articol, ex. Wikipedia:Pagini de șters/Mihail Gavril (2), și se decide păstrarea acestuia, se creează o pagină goală de tipul Mihail Gavril (2).— Ionutzmovie discută 17 decembrie 2016 01:04 (EET)
    Am modificat regexul care identifică titlul articolului. Acum rămâne de văzut când vom mai avea un astfel de caz. —Andreidiscuție 12 ianuarie 2017 12:10 (EET)
  5. Twinkle aruncă un warning în consolă: Regiunea_Pskov:322 Gadget "twinkle" styles loaded twice. Migrate to type=general. See <https://phabricator.wikimedia.org/T42284>. --Strainu (دسستي‎)  18 decembrie 2016 19:19 (EET)
      Rezolvat [1] --Strainu (دسستي‎)  28 decembrie 2016 13:15 (EET)
  6. Twinkle strică legăturile către hărți (clic pe glob la Lista stațiilor de metrou din București cu TW activat - harta care se încarcă e albă): phab:T154117--Strainu (دسستي‎)  25 decembrie 2016 23:57 (EET)
      Rezolvat în Kartographer, dar mă aștept să existe aceeași problemă și în alte componente - vezi bugul următor.--Strainu (دسستي‎)  4 ianuarie 2017 10:26 (EET)
  7. MediaWiki:Gadget-morebits.js redefinește array-ul din js, făcând ca următorul cod să nu funcționeze as expected: for (var key in []) { console.log( key );} Ar trebui actualizat morebits (selectiv: 65d0a34 și 4e5907a, sau complet).--Strainu (دسستي‎)  4 ianuarie 2017 10:26 (EET)
    Am adus la zi Morebits și am adaptat Twinkle. —Andreidiscuție 2 februarie 2017 19:43 (EET)
    Checked, funcționează, mulțumesc. Cred că o să mai apară câteva buguri ca cel cu textul pus după lună, dar overall e o mișcare bună.--Strainu (دسستي‎)  3 februarie 2017 00:09 (EET)
  8. Modificările multiple efectuate anonim de la adrese IPv6 nu se anulează în bloc (ca în cazul altora), ci se anulează mereu doar prima.
    Se întâmpla pentru că în lista de modificări istorice adresele IPv6 apar cu litere mari în dreptul cifrelor hexa mai mari ca 9, dar comparația se face cu o valoare cu litere mici. Am modificat recent, mie mi s-a comportat ok la un test, dar am nevoie de o confirmare, dat fiind că acest caz e relativ rar. —Andreidiscuție 25 ianuarie 2017 18:43 (EET)
    O încercare de revenire operată zilele astea sugerează că încă nu funcționează. —Andreidiscuție 10 martie 2017 21:23 (EET)
  9. (raportat la Cafenea) Nu se marchează ca patrulate modificările asupra cărora se operează revenirea cu Twinkle
      Rezolvat —Andreidiscuție 25 ianuarie 2017 18:44 (EET)
  10. Când adaugi formatul {{invitație}} pe paginile de discuție a utilizatorilor anonimi, chiar dacă tu menționezi la ce pagină a făcut modificarea bună, Twinkle nu trimite legătură spre acea pagină, ci spre pagina personală de utilizator. A pățit-o și Wintereu și eu, vezi aici și aici.--StoneJustice (discuție) 6 februarie 2017 23:30 (EET)
    Eu aș tinde oricum către formate mai personalizate (pe tematici și alte criterii), în genul celor de la en.wikipedia. Prespunând că ar exista, s-ar putea pune la secțiunea Welcoming committee templates? Wintereu 6 februarie 2017 23:45 (EET)
    Cred că trebuie să debifați opțiunea "Adaugă numele de utilizator la format" în preferințe. La en.wp parametrul 1 reprezintă semnătura, de aceea e implementat în acest fel.--Strainu (دسستي‎)  7 februarie 2017 00:26 (EET)--Strainu (دسستي‎)  7 februarie 2017 00:26 (EET)
    Mersi. O știam debifată (am mai folosit-o și înainte), dar de când cu micile probleme de TW pe care le-am avut, probabil că în mod involuntar am reactivat-o. Legat de mesajul meu anterior, am văzut cu ocazia asta că există opțiunea de a adăuga formate de Bun venit și invitații. Wintereu 7 februarie 2017 00:42 (EET)
  11. Venind de pe site-ul mobil, TW îmi spune că nu îl pot folosi deoarece contul e prea nou, dar mă lasă totuși să îl folosesc.
    Problema pe larg: am intrat pe un articol la ro.m.wikipedia.org (eram autentificat). Am apăsat pe legătura "Desktop" din partea de jos a paginii și am fost redirecționat corect, fiind în continuare autentificat. Am apăsat pe tabul marcat "TW", moment în care mi-a apărut un pop-up cu "contul dvs. e prea nou...". Am apăsat OK și am apăsat din nou pe "TW" și apoi pe "PȘ". Mai departe procesul s-a derulat normal. Browser Opera Mobile 41.2.2246.111806 pe Android 6.--Strainu (دسستي‎)  15 februarie 2017 11:34 (EET)
    O cunosc, e veche și iritantă. Am văzut și pe Firefox și Chrome pe Android. Cred că ține de modul cum e interpretat tapul de pe touch screen (practic, nu există hover acolo, așa cum se face cu un mouse). Și pe desktop, dacă faci click pe TW, îți dă același mesaj. La tratarea acelui eveniment e de lucrat. —Andreidiscuție 15 februarie 2017 11:50 (EET)
      Rezolvat. Fixul era simplu, dar nu m-am gândit că e alt eveniment pe mobil. Mulțumesc Andrei.--Strainu (دسستي‎)  15 februarie 2017 12:05 (EET)
  12. În anumite combinații de mesaje (iw? necat?) TW inserează {{problemearticol}} cu un singur parametru. Vezi [2]--Strainu (دسستي‎)  31 martie 2017 19:23 (EEST)
    Încă e cam haotică implementarea acolo, trebuie rescrise niște părți. Știu de deficiențe. —Andreidiscuție 15 ianuarie 2018 15:25 (EET)
  13. În ultima vreme îmi tot dă mesaje de eroare (API Error) la propunerile de ștergere dar nu apuc să le citesc. E vreo metodă să le recuperez de undeva?--Strainu (دسستي‎)  26 septembrie 2017 14:49 (EEST)
  14. Nu se aplică corect noinclude la PȘ. Vezi [3] (știu sigur că l-am bifat).--Strainu (دسستي‎)  15 ianuarie 2018 14:41 (EET)
  15. Nu se închid corect discuțiile din spații de nume non-articol (se caută Discuție:Format:...). Întâlnit la Wikipedia:Pagini_de_șters/Format:Compozitori_de_renume.--Strainu (دسستي‎)  15 ianuarie 2018 14:41 (EET)
    Închiderea discuțiilor e un cod problematic; la en.wp parcă renunțaseră la el, aici l-am mai menținut, dar într-adevăr se cam împiedică la alte spații de nume. —Andreidiscuție 15 ianuarie 2018 15:25 (EET)
Înapoi la pagina de proiect „Twinkle”.